Floor drain cleaning


drain snakingNumerous homes have flooring drains in their basements, utility room, garages and patios to keep excess water from flooding and causing damage. Because basements are the bottom-most parts of houses, flooring drains are especially typical in them, since rain and drain water can so quickly flow down and flood basements. Like drains you may discover in your sink or bath tub, floor drains are equipped with traps underneath. These traps must be kept full of water to avoid drain gases and odors from escaping into the room.

The most typical issue with floor drains is merely that they or the traps can end up being clogged with dirt and particles. Basement plumbing tips


Appropriately keeping your basement flooring drain and sump pump will make them less likely to require repair work. Here are a number of maintenance tips:

Keep your trap seal full: Because your basement flooring drain does not get a lot of use, it's essential to manually keep the trap seal below it filled with water. If the trap seal isn't complete, it could enable drain gases to support into your basement. So exactly what should you do? Just put a bucket of diluted the drain once in awhile.
Check your sump pump frequently: You can utilize the same approach to test your sump pump prior to the rainy season starts. Pour a container of water into the sump pit - the mechanism should switch on, pump the water away and turn off.
